Output 8f139583cb7bc55cd1fef4e09480796f8317d5c754cb4b6464c7c4eaaff5dc87:1

value
25063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39d60925235e955b363147ebca18e29ce683d102 OP_EQUAL
address
36xpqwXD9p1RLj6r6mZ6iebMBCK8DRrfKy
transaction
8f139583cb7bc55cd1fef4e09480796f8317d5c754cb4b6464c7c4eaaff5dc87
confirmations
276584
spent
true